New Hampton Inn opens in Pleasanton

Hampton Hotels, the global brand of nearly 1,900 mid-priced Hampton Inn, Hampton Inn & Suites, and Hampton by Hilton hotels, announced the opening of its newest property, the 63-room Hampton Inn Pleasanton located at 2057 West Oaklawn Rd.

“Hampton combines quality, innovation, comfort and plenty of value-added extras, making it the brand of choice in the marketplace today,” said Lonnie Kim, general manager of the Hampton Inn Pleasanton.  “Quality accommodations and amenities combined with proactive, friendly service from our team members - all backed by the 100% Hampton® Guarantee - make us highly competitive in the area.”

The hotel is owned and operated by Prayosa Hospitality. It is the first Hampton property in Pleasanton, ahead of 29 more Hampton hotels slated to be opened in Texas and more than 250 Hampton properties in the pipeline in the U.S.

The Hampton Inn Pleasanton is just minutes from Pleasanton Municipal Airport, in the heart of the city’s business district. The property is in close proximity to Eagle Ford Shale and Costal Bend College, as well as Highway 281 and 97, providing easy access to Pleasanton’s local attractions, such as the Longhorn Museum and Atascosa River Park.

The hotel offers amenities, such as free, hot breakfast, tea and coffee bar, modern business center and outdoor pool and hot tub. Guest rooms are equipped with the Clean and Fresh Hampton bedTM, free high-speed Internet access, microwave and refrigerator.

Hampton Hotels employs a unique culture of hospitality - called “Hamptonality.”  This term describes each hotel’s approach to friendly customer service, anticipating guests’ needs and providing travelers with helpful suggestions about area attractions, historical facts and fun things do around town. Additionally, hotels are infused with local photography and art work, highlighting each property’s connection and support to its own community.
